The Nama J2 juicer comes with a safety feature that makes is both child-safe and incredibly practical to use. When you add your produce, you close the lid, turn on the juicer and the juicer starts doing its magic. If you open the lid, it automatically (and immediately) turns off, so you never have to worry about leaving the juicer unattended around children. The juicer comes with a three-tier system. The first tier consists of its wide, bulky base where its motor and power dial is found. This dial can be set to On, Off, and Reverse. We tried out several juices in the Nama Vitality 5800, first off orange juice. Oranges need to be peeled and broken into smaller segments so they’ll fit into the feed chute. From 1.47lb / 667g oranges we got 0.13 gallon / 499 ml juice which is a good yield of almost 75%, meaning only 25% of the oranges ended up in the waste pulp container. The orange juice was very clear and smooth with absolutely no froth at all, an impressive result.
